Editor,

I would like to share my personal experience working with mayoral candidate Sharon Emerson. The woman I know is confidant, decisive, compassionate and hardworking. I have worked closely with her for about a year and when I first met her I was a little intimidated. She is an intelligent woman who voices her opinions clearly and she is knowledgeable on a wide range of topics.

I wasn’t sure how she would react to my differing points of view. However, what I found was a remarkable woman that was willing to change her opinion when given new information that she hadn’t considered. In my experience that is truly rare. She doesn’t change her opinion on whim, but if she discovers that she has missed an important piece of information she will, at the very least, reconsider her point of view rather than stubbornly holding to her position.

Given how decisive she is, I have underestimated her compassion on more than one occasion. I have gone to her to ask her advice about dealing with people who were in crisis. Prior to talking to her, I had assumed I knew her opinion only to be surprised by how kind, gentle and compassionate she can be to those in need. I am certain that I am not the only person who has underestimated her.

Her critics may say she is too opinionated. I would counter that she is capable of articulating a point of view and enjoys a good debate. Some say she is hard to get along with. I would suggest that they take the time to actually talk to her. They will find that she is actually very considerate, funny and engaging. Most surprising of all, she isn’t unmovable. Her opinion can be changed if you have the right facts to back it up.

Sharon Emerson is a woman who is willing to discuss a wide range of topics, research her opinion, consider other peoples’ points of view, re-evaluate and even change her position if presented with new information. She is decisive and willing to make hard choices when she has to, yet compassionate to those in need. I really can’t think of traits that I would want more in an elected official.
